Casilla came out didn’t get the ball and clattered the defender for a yellow card and the free kick that led to the first goal then came and failed to get the ball for the third. 3 points lost yesterday. Brentford he’s in no mans land and gives maupay the chance to shoot early at 0-0. He does something similar almost every game they just don’t always cost us. He’s a decent shot stopper on the occasions he’s in position to make a stop.

If you look at the stats his saves per game are almost identical to bpf but he lets a similar proportion of goals in ( slightly more I think). So he’s not worked harder than bpf And doesn’t make more saves. Tells you, there’s little in it... so who’s the better distributor?

Reality is it’s not easy being a keeper for Leeds. We play a high line with fullbacks as wingers leaving us open to the counter so keepers aren’t busy and are then facing a gilt edged chance out of the blue.

What the goals conceded column with either keeper actually tells you is that our problems are at the other end of the pitch.
